Senior Salesforce Developer

Responsibilities:




  • Develop, customize, and maintain Salesforce applications, integrations, tooling and enhancements using Apex, Lightning Web Components, Github actions and other related Salesforce technologies.
  • Collaborate with product managers, administrators, and stakeholders to gather requirements and provide technical guidance on Salesforce best practices.
  • Design and implement data models, custom objects, workflows, and automation using declarative tools.
  • Perform unit testing, debugging, and troubleshooting of Salesforce applications to ensure high quality and performance.
  • Integrate Salesforce with external systems and third-party applications using REST and related middleware tools.
  • Provide technical expertise and guidance on Salesforce platform capabilities, limitations, and potential solutions.
  • Stay updated with the latest Salesforce releases, features, and industry trends to propose innovative solutions and improvements.
  • Participate in code reviews, peer programming, and knowledge sharing sessions to foster a collaborative and learning-oriented environment.
  • Document technical designs, specifications, and development processes to ensure comprehensive understanding and maintainable solutions.


Requirements:




  • 5+ years of experience as a Salesforce Developer with a deep understanding of the Salesforce platform, including Apex, Lightning Web Components, and Salesforce configuration.
  • Experience with Salesforce integrations using REST APIs, middleware and ETL processes/tools.
  • Solid understanding of object-oriented programming principles and design patterns.
  • Excellent problem-solving skills and ability to translate business requirements into technical solutions.
  • Strong communication and collaboration skills to effectively work with cross-functional teams and stakeholders and demonstrate value.
  • Salesforce certifications, such as Salesforce Certified Platform Developer I/II, are highly desirable.
  • Experience with Agile development methodologies and tools.
  • Experience with Salesforce DevOps tooling/frameworks and SFDX CLI, VS Code